What is the difference between a metaphor and an analogy?.

Respuesta :

niydiaw2009
niydiaw2009 niydiaw2009
  • 04-03-2022

Answer: The difference between a Metaphor and an Analogy is that a Metaphor is often poetically saying something is something else. And an Analogy is saying something is like something else to make an explanatory point. :)
